Hurricane Fausto moving toward Hawaiʻi, dangerous surf forecast

Sattellite image of Hurricane Fausto at UTC on July 25, 2026. Credit: NOAA/GOES-19, Zoom Earth, The Watchers Hurricane Fausto is forecast to affect the Hawaiian Islands with hazardous conditions beginning as early as July 27, with damaging winds and heavy rainfall possible as the cyclone approaches the state. The specific extent and location of hazardous impacts will become clearer over the next several days as forecast confidence improves. “There are no coastal watches or warnings in effect. Interests in the Hawaiian Islands should monitor the progress of Fausto,” the National Hurricane Center (NHC) reported. At HST ( UTC) on July 25, Hurricane Fausto was centered about 1950 km (1 210 miles) east of Hilo, Hawaiʻi. The system was moving west at 22 km/h (14 mph) with maximum sustained winds of 155 km/h (100 mph). The estimated minimum central pressure was 971 hPa. Hurricane-force winds extended up to 65 km (40 miles) from the center, while tropical-storm-force winds reached outward as far as 335 km (205 miles). Long-period swells generated -facing shores of the eastern Hawaiian Islands on July 26 before spreading westward overnight into July 27. Surf is forecast to continue building through July 28 as the hurricane moves closer to the state. The increasing swell is expected to produce life-threatening surf and dangerous rip currents along exposed east-facing coastlines. Residents and visitors are advised to follow guidance issued , as forecast details and potential impacts will continue to evolve over the coming days.
